  1. Standing waves can be produced

$(1999,3 M)$

(a) on a string clamped at both ends

(b) on a string clamped at one end and free at the other

(c) when an incident wave gets reflected from a wall

(d) when two identical waves with a phase difference of $\pi$ are moving in the same direction

Show Answer

Answer:

Correct Answer: 42.$(a, b, c)$

Solution:

Formula:

Standing/Stationary Waves:

  1. Standing waves can be produced only when two similar type of waves (same frequency and speed, but amplitude may be different) travel in opposite directions.
